WebHere's how. Click File > Options > Proofing, clear the Check spelling as you type box, and click OK. To turn spell check back on, repeat the process and select the Check spelling as you type box. To check spelling manually, click Review > Spelling & Grammar. But do remember to run spell check.

WebDefinitions of in-situ. adjective. being in the original position; not having been moved. “the archeologists could date the vase because it was in-situ ”. “an in-situ investigator”. … reading high school facebookWebDec 26, 2024 · in situ, meaning “in its original place.”. In biology, this often describes a plant or animal in its native habitat. Example: The wolf was photographed in situ. in vitro, meaning “taking place outside an organism.”. in vivo, meaning “taking place inside a living organism.”.
